When the technician arrived, they precisely measured the entire wall space. We talked about diverse wood shades and useful storage options for my various files. I selected a clean oak style that matched the space perfectly. The layout phase was honestly quite involved. We spent nearly an hour just discussing where the power outlets should go and how to hide the unsightly wires for my monitor and printer. I had very specific requirements for a pull-out keyboard tray because I suffer from occasional wrist strain, and the designer was able to suggest a height that was ergonomically sound. It was fascinating to see how they could maximize every square inch of a room that I had previously thought was too awkward for anything substantial. They pointed out that the ceiling was slightly uneven, a common quirk in older properties around this part of town, and explained how the top cabinetry would be scribed to the ceiling to ensure there were no unsightly gaps. This level of technical observation gave me a lot of peace of mind. I also appreciated that they didn't try to upsell me on unnecessary gadgets; instead, they focused on the structural integrity of the shelving and the durability of the work surface, which would need to withstand daily use for years to come. We looked at samples of handles and copyrights, and I opted for soft-close doors to avoid any loud slamming noises during late-night work sessions. The fitting day ultimately came about after a slight wait for the custom parts. The installer was highly punctual and immediately protected my flooring with thick dust sheets. I observed as they assembled the lower units first. Seeing the skeleton of the office take shape was a highlight of the day. They used professional-grade levels and laser tools to ensure everything was perfectly straight, which was no small feat given my wonky walls. The noise was manageable, mostly just the hum of a drill and the occasional tap of a rubber mallet. By midday, the main carcass of the desk and the overhead cupboards were in place, and I could already see the potential of the space. The installer took the time to explain how they were anchoring the units to the wall for safety, especially since I planned on filling the upper shelves with heavy reference books. One minor issue arose when a specific trim piece was slightly damaged in transit, but the installer handled it professionally by ordering a replacement immediately and finishing the rest of the job so it was still usable in the meantime. The attention to detail during the finishing stage was what really impressed me; they used color-matched sealant to fill any tiny joins and wiped down every surface until it gleamed. It didn't feel like a construction site; it felt like a room being cared for. They even helped me route my existing cables through the new ports before they left, which saved me hours of crawling around on the floor later.
